Welders have the ability to work in a range of industries. According to the BLS (Bureau of Labor Statistics) “the basic skills of welding are similar across industries, so welders can easily shift from one industry to another.” The job outlook for welders is good, with 424,700 welding jobs filled in 2018. However, welders without up to date training may face strong competition for jobs. Welders are expected to earn an average of $19.89/hour or $41,380 annually*.
